你的GitHub Guides探险

简介: Hello World计算机编程领域的历史悠久的传统。所以GitHub:hello World !什么是GitHub?GitHub是版本控制和协作的代码托管平台。

Hello World

计算机编程领域的历史悠久的传统。所以GitHub:hello World !

什么是GitHub?

GitHub是版本控制和协作的代码托管平台。它可以让你和其他人在任何地方一起工作。

  • 写在前面。我也没有使用过GitHub,用Google翻译,中英文切换着使用的。开始冒险,

进入GitHub

注册一个GitHub账号,使用Google,QQ邮箱注册都行,进入GitHub,点击”Read the guide“ —-阅读指南

全是英文的慌不慌,英文好的人直接阅读,英不好的请使用Google浏览器,翻译成中文。

创建你的一个GitHub项目

点击 ”Start a project“

构建项目的步骤:
                        创建并使用存储库
                        开始并管理一个新的分支
                        对文件进行更改并将其作为提交推送到GitHub
                        打开并合并请求

第一步:创建并使用repository存储库

理解成项目的仓库就好,存储库可以包含文件夹和文件,图像,视频,电子表格和数据集等等。

Owner告示你这个仓库属于谁,
Respository name:创建仓库的名字
Description:项目描述,
Public/Private 公共或者私有,点击创建仓库即可。Create repository

第二步:创建master分支

分支是一种合作方式。在GitHub上,开发人员使用分支机制,来保持错误修复和功能工作与我们master主分支区别开来。当一个变化准备就绪时,他们将分支合并到master。

默认情况下,你的仓库中有一个master被认为是最终分支的分支。在提交之前,我们使用分支来进行实验和编辑master。

点击Branch:master 创建一个分支
(相同项目的分支,你可以在里面进行增加、修改)。

第三步:进行并提交更改

点击该README.md文件,进行修改编辑。
完成,填写Commit changes (修改人和修改的内容是什么)

第四步。打开合并请求

很好的编辑!现在您已经在分支上进行了更改master,您可以打开一个拉取请求。拉取请求显示来自两个分支的内容的差异。变化或者添加与减法分别以绿色和红色显示

1.点击Pull Request
2.选择您所做的分支与master(原始)比较,确认差异
3.点击Create pull request,准备将你修改的代码分支合并到master(原始)上。
4.填写更新日志,点击Marge pull request 合并分支。

你的第一个GitHub项目 Hello World!完成了!

相关文章
|
12月前
|
人工智能 自然语言处理 API
GitHub上的AutoGPT神秘的面纱
-c:是否开启连续模式。这是一个非常危险的命令!表示 autogpt 会不经过你的同意全自动执行,包括但不限于死循环、无限创建文件、占满空间后删除你电脑上的文件等等。就和人类一样:可能会为了达到目的不择手段!
112 0
|
Arthas 算法 Java
这5个GitHub项目+3个网站,助你一飞冲天!
这5个GitHub项目+3个网站,助你一飞冲天! 小伙伴们周末好呀,这次来更新一波学习资源啦~ 👍 之前推荐过一些书,这次我们就来看看 4ye 平时常关顾的一些学习网站叭!😋 (同时会更新在菜单栏的 宝藏资源 中,方便查找) 资源一览 image-20210807235820378 CyC2018 / CS-Notes 高达 136K star 的项目! 😄 📚 技术面试必备基础知识、Leetcode、计算机操作系统、计算机网络、系统设计 概览图 地址👉 github.com/CyC2018/CS-… ima
766 0
|
设计模式 监控 算法
Github 助你实现“家国梦”
首先一点,这个游戏有30个建筑,但是只有9块地,同时会有各种不同的政策影响建筑的收益。所以,安放不同建筑是会影响收益高低的,且在一定的条件之下必然存在一个最优的摆放方式。这实际上就是算法中一个典型的最优化问题。
|
Devops 程序员 开发工具
C++——程序员的逼格神器-github
C++——程序员的逼格神器-github
|
数据可视化 JavaScript Java
Github这五个基本用发,让你我开始起飞
Github这五个基本用发,让你我开始起飞
Github这五个基本用发,让你我开始起飞
|
数据可视化 BI 开发工具
学会这几招,轻松让你的github脱颖而出
今天分享的内容我想每一位对开源感兴趣的朋友都或多或少的知道, 也是我在做开源项目中用到的一些强大的工具, 可以让我们的开源项目和 github 主页更加富有展现力, 最后会分享一个我自己的 github 主页的 readme.md, 大家可以参考学习一下. 在读完本文之后大家可以收获:
148 0
|
人工智能 并行计算 安全
开发者必备!Github上1.6W星的「黑魔法」,早知道就不会秃头了
当程序员谈论开发设计时,常常会聊到非常多的定律,而Github上的一个名为「hacker-laws」的仓库收录了一些最常见的定律、原则等,获得了16.3k的Star。
223 0
开发者必备!Github上1.6W星的「黑魔法」,早知道就不会秃头了
|
Java 程序员
GitHub搜索技巧
GitHub搜索技巧
269 0
GitHub搜索技巧